Bonfire Night Dinner Ideas: Cozy and Warming Dishes for a Festive Gathering

Bonfire Night, also known as Guy Fawkes Night, is a traditional British celebration held annually on November 5th. It commemorates the failed attempt to blow up the Houses of Parliament in 1605. The festivities typically include bonfires, fireworks, and a range of food and drink.

If you're planning to host a Bonfire Night gathering, consider these cozy and warming dinner ideas that will keep your guests satisfied and filled with festive cheer:

Hearty Soups and Stews

* Beef and Ale Stew: A classic British dish that's perfect for a cold evening. Slow-cooked beef, vegetables, and a rich ale-based gravy create a hearty and flavorful stew.
* Pumpkin Soup: A seasonal favorite with a sweet and savory flavor. Roasted pumpkin, onions, and vegetable broth combine for a creamy and comforting soup.

Grilled Delights

* Hot Dogs: A simple but satisfying option that can be topped with a variety of condiments, such as ketchup, mustard, and relish.
* Bratwurst: A German sausage that's grilled to perfection and served with a side of sauerkraut.
* Roasted Marshmallows: A traditional Bonfire Night treat that's always a hit with kids and adults alike. Roast marshmallows over the bonfire and enjoy them on their own or dip them in hot chocolate.

Savory Sides

* Baked Potatoes: A versatile side dish that can be topped with a variety of fillings, such as cheese, chili, or baked beans.
* Corn on the Cob: Grilled or roasted corn on the cob is a delicious and healthy option that adds a touch of sweetness.
* Apple Crumble: A classic British dessert that's perfect for a chilly night. Apples, cinnamon, and sugar are topped with a buttery crumble and baked until golden brown.

Warm Drinks

* Mulled Wine: A festive drink made with red wine, spices, and citrus fruits.
* Hot Apple Cider: A warm and comforting drink that's perfect for a bonfire night gathering.
* Spiced Hot Chocolate: A sweet and creamy drink that can be made with milk or water and flavored with spices like cinnamon, nutmeg, and ginger.
